Menos atletas, mais oportunidades: base aumenta influência no São Paulo

MatériaMais Notícias

Falta de dinheiro, justificativa para os investimentos em Cotia e filosofia de jogo de Rogério Ceni. Esses são alguns dos fatores que fizeram o São Paulo intensificar o uso dos produtos de suas categorias de base nesta temporada. Nos últimos dois anos, as crias do CFA Laudo Natel cavaram cada vez mais espaço e agora se consolidam como armas do Tricolor.

No atual elenco, são 12 atletas com passagem pela base do clube: o goleiro Lucas Perri, os zagueiros Breno, Rodrigo Caio e Lucão, o lateral-esquerdo Júnior Tavares, os volantes Wellington, João Schmidt, Araruna e Militão, os meias Lucas Fernandes e Shaylon e o atacante Luiz Araújo. Perri e Militão são os únicos que ainda não jogaram, enquanto Foguete e Lyanco atuaram uma vez cada, mas foram transferidos – Vila Nova, por empréstimo, e Torino (ITA), respectivamente.

Como em outros anos, a comissão técnica profissional também observou jovens talentos durante os treinamentos. Em 2017, as oportunidades foram dadas a nomes como Caique, Léo Natel, Oliveira, Roni e Tom. Tudo cumprindo uma promessa de Ceni e seguindo o histórico do auxiliar inglês Michael Beale, oriundo das bases de Liverpool e Chelsea.

Mas para provar que Cotia e Barra Funda estão integrados de vez é preciso comparar os dois últimos anos, quando o São Paulo mergulhou em problemas políticos e financeiros e passou a apontar a base como salvação. Neste ano, que começou a ter jogos em 19 de janeiro e soma 25 partidas disputadas, já foram registradas 129 participações de atletas formados em Cotia, com seis gols marcados e dez assistências.

Na temporada passada, 15 atletas da base foram utilizados ao longo de 11 meses de competições e o número de participações de pratas da casa foi de 192, com 13 gols e nove assistências. Já em 2015, foram 159 participações, com seis gols e seis assistências durante todo o ano.

A melhora dos números pode ser explicada pelo aumento da experiência dos garotos, calejados pelos maus momentos do clube. Há ainda o respaldo da torcida, sempre favorável a mais espaço para Cotia. E, claro, o de Ceni. Basta ver que Araruna e Júnior, promovidos em janeiro, já somam 17 e 23 partidas, respectivamente. Confiança do chefe e sequência para desenvolver o talento.

O Mito chegou a promover outros nomes, como os zagueiros Tormena e Kal, mas optou por emprestá-los para ganhar experiência em outras equipes. Além deles, foram cedidos o zagueiro Maidana, os volantes Banguelê e Artur, o lateral-esquerdo Matheus Reis e o centroavante Pedro. E todos sabem: quem se destacar certamente estará no radar da equipe principal do Tricolor.

Ainda assim, há cautela de Ceni. Preocupado com a falta de ritmo de Lucas Fernandes, recém-recuperado de duas lesões, pediu que o meia fosse aproveitado pelo sub-20 no Campeonato Paulista da categoria. Shaylon, com dificuldades para enfrentar a concorrência no setor ofensivo, pode ser emprestado a um clube da Série A. Preocupação com o futuro.

Watson could open in Tests – Nielsen

Shane Watson’s best chance of a Test recall would be to make another push to open and eventually succeed Matthew Hayden, according to Australia’s coach Tim Nielsen

Cricinfo staff02-Jul-2008
Shane Watson made 126 opening in the third ODI on Sunday and Tim Nielsen believes he could do a similar job in Tests © Getty Images
Shane Watson’s best chance of a Test recall would be to make another push to open and eventually succeed Matthew Hayden, according to Australia’s coach Tim Nielsen. Watson scored his first one-day international century against West Indies on Sunday and the innings means that when Hayden returns from his achilles tendon injury, Watson is likely to join him coming in first.After his 126 guided Australia to a comfortable win, Watson spoke of his desire to fight back into the Test side, where he has not been seen since making the last of his three appearances in November 2005. Nielsen believes Watson can make a case to open at the highest level and could be a genuine option whenever Hayden, 36, retires.”I don’t think it can hurt, the fact that he is opening in one-day cricket,” Nielsen told AAP. “We’ve seen a lot of guys come through the system opening in one-day cricket and then getting an opportunity at Test match cricket. So if he can show that he’s got the ability to cope with the quality bowlers with the new ball in one-day cricket over the next 12 months, whenever the opportunity arises, his hat will certainly be in the ring.”However, Watson will need to lift his first-class output to make the transition viable. He typically bats at No. 4 or 5 for Queensland and although he tried to prove himself as an opener when Justin Langer’s Test spot was up for grabs, Watson’s six performances coming in first for his state were dire: 0, 0, 0, 15, 13 and 0.He also has the problem of being behind Simon Katich in the pecking order after Katich burst back onto the Test scene in the Caribbean with back-to-back centuries opening while Hayden was injured. Whatever the case, Nielsen is pleased that Watson has enjoyed a six-month injury-free period after his latest hamstring problem.”Selectors have shown some real good strength to stick with him and offer him chances whenever they can, and I think over the long run that’s how you get players who can slot into any role,” Nielsen said. “He’s done that brilliantly this tour.”He adds a lot of flexibility to our group. Shane is somebody who is good enough to come in as a batsman, who can hold his own as a bowler and does a good job in the field. International teams get caught out a little bit by relying on bits-and-pieces allrounders, who are not good enough in either batting and bowling. Watto is actually a good player as either a bowler or a batsman.”

Australia name preliminary Champions Trophy squad

Australia have announced their preliminary 30-man squad for the Champions Trophy in Pakistan in September, with Shaun Tait being recalled as he continues to work his way back into international cricket after taking a self-imposed break due to exhaustion

Cricinfo staff10-Jul-2008Preliminary squadRicky Ponting (capt), Michael Clarke (vice-captain), George Bailey,Doug Bollinger,Nathan Bracken, Stuart Clark, Dan Cullen, Xavier Doherty, Brett Geeves, Ryan Harris,Brad Haddin, Nathan Hauritz, Matthew Hayden, Brad Hodge, James Hopes, David Hussey, Michael Hussey, Phil Jaques, Mitchell Johnson, Simon Katich, Brett Lee, Shaun Marsh, Ashley Noffke, Tim Paine, Luke Ronchi, Andrew Symonds, Shaun Tait, Adam Voges, Shane Watson, Cameron White Australia have announced their preliminary 30-man squad for the Champions Trophy in Pakistan in September, with Shaun Tait being recalled as he continues to work his way back into international cricket after taking a self-imposed break due to exhaustion. The squad also includes five newcomers in Xavier Doherty, Ryan Harris, Brett Geeves, George Bailey and Tim Paine.”The squad recognises the continued success of the one-day side and its outstanding efforts in the West Indies, together with the strong performance of our young emerging talent in the Ford Ranger Cup,” Andrew Hilditch, the chairman of Australia’s national selection panel, said.Offspinners Nathan Hauritz and Dan Cullen and legspinner Cameron White will stake their claim for the spinners’ spot in the final squad. “Closer to final selection a decision will be made on the make-up of the squad and whether a specialist spinner needs to be added to the final 15,” Hilditch said. Beau Casson, he said, missed out as he needed “more exposure” to the one-day format.Tasmania’s Ford Rangers Cup success last season means that they have provided four of the newcomers to the squad. Doherty, the left-arm spinner, and seamer Geeves were the among four bowlers who finished joint-highest on the wicket-takers’ list with 15 scalps. Paine, the wicketkeeper who has turned into a specialist batsman, contributed 261 runs at 37.38, while Bailey, despite his limited success – 258 runs at 25.80 – is marked as one for the future. Harris, the bowling allrounder who moved to Queensland from South Australia, has taken 49 wickets at 35.51 in his List A career.Hildicth added that Ben Hilfenhaus was not considered as he was recovering from an injury. The squad will be whittled down to a final 15 on or before the August 11 deadline.

Pundit rules out Gareth Bale returning to Tottenham - Exclusive

Dean Windass has virtually ruled out Gareth Bale returning to Tottenham for a third time.

The Welshman made a sensational return to north London on a season-long loan spell last summer after being forced out due to his toxic relationship Zinedine Zidane.

Bale hardly featured during the first half of the campaign, but his blistering goalscoring form from February onwards led to the possibility of a third return.

However, Zidane left Real Madrid and the end of last season and was replaced by Carlo Ancelotti, the man who signed Bale from Tottenham back in 2013, which appeared to end any possibility of the 32-year-old re-joining.

Bale was asked about his future by Sky Sports on the final day of the Premier League season, but revealed that his answer would cause chaos and said he would wait until after the Euro’s.

However, Bale hasn’t touched on his Madrid future since Wales were knocked out by Denmark in the last 16, although the fact he’s already featured in pre-season would suggest he’s remaining with the Spanish giants for the final year of his deal.

Windass exclusively told The Transfer Tavern:

“I think with Zidane leaving, that’ll be a relief for Gareth. He’s got a new manager, it’s a fresh slate. The only unhappiness was him and Zidane.

“He’s clearly happy living there, because he’s always dug his heels in, I can only see Gareth Bale staying another two years and then retiring. I can’t see him going back to Tottenham, not in a breath.”

فيديو | نيمار يقود البرازيل للفوز على اليابان ودياً

حقق منتخب البرازيل فوزًا صعبًا وديًا على نظيره الياباني بهدف نظيف في المباراة التي جمعت بينهما ضمن جولة السيليساو الأسيوية، على ملعب الاستاد الوطني باليابان.

شوط المباراة الأول انتهى بالتعادل السلبي، وأجرى المدير الفني البرازيلي تيتي العديد من التغييرات، من بينها ريتشارليسون مهاجم إيفرتون.

لاعب التوفيز حصل على ركلة جزاء في الدقيقة 77، ترجمها نيمار ببراعة على يمين حارس أصحاب الأرض.

أصدقاء القائد يوشيدا لم يتمكنوا من مجاراة البرازيل، وانتهت المباراة بالفوز 1/0 للسيليساو، بعدما اكتسحوا كوريا بخماسية منذ أيام قليلة.

المنتخب البرازيلي اختتم استعداداته الأسيوية لمواجهة الأرجنتين في السوبر كلاسيكو بمباراة مؤجلة من تصفيات كأس العالم، يوم السبت المقبل.

Pundit praises Everton’s transfer business - Exclusive

Speaking exclusively to Football FanCast, former Everton striker Marcus Bent has praised Rafael Benitez’s transfer business.

Whilst the Toffees manager hasn’t been able to recruit the high-profile likes of James Rodriguez and Allan, like Carlo Ancelotti did 12 months ago, he’s still added three new faces to his current squad.

Free agents Andros Townsend and Asmir Begovic joined following their releases from Crystal Palace and Bournemouth respectively, whilst Demarai Gray made a swift return to the Premier League, just two years after he left to sign for Bayer Leverkusen.

Benitez doesn’t perhaps have the same attraction as his predecessor but is clearly looking into bringing in players with Premier League experience, with Newcastle’s Sean Longstaff and Harry Winks two other names who’ve been mentioned as potential incomings.

Those three additions, who all played at least 45 minutes at Manchester United on Sunday, will bolster Benitez’s squad, although they’re unlikely to make the difference in helping Everton bring European football back to Goodison Park.

However, Bent exclusively told Football FanCast that he’s on board with the business his former side have managed to complete, simply saying: “I think it’s smart business.”

الأعلى أجرًا.. تفاصيل اتفاق ريال مدريد مع فينيسيوس على تجديد عقده

توصل نادي ريال مدريد لاتفاق كامل مع جناح الفريق الأول لكرة القدم فينيسيوس جونيور، لتجديد عقده والاستمرار لسنوات أخرى داخل قلعة “سانتياجو برنابيو”.

وقدم فينيسيوس مستوى رائعًا مع ريال مدريد في الموسم الماضي تحت قيادة المدير الفني، كارلو أنشيلوتي، وسجل هدف فوز الملكي ببطولة دوري أبطال أوروبا على ليفربول وحصد لقب الدوري والسوبر الإسباني.

وبحسب متخصص الانتقالات في “سكاي سبورت”، فابرزيو رومانو، عبر حسابه الرسمي على “تويتر”، كتب: “الاتفاق تم، فينيسيوس سيوقع على عقد جديد مع ريال مدريد حتى يونيو 2026، أي لمدة 4 سنوات”.

وتابع: “سيتم الإعلان الرسمي عن العقد الجديد في يونيو، راتب جديد مثله مثل اللاعبين الأعلى أجرًا في ريال مدريد”.

وأضاف في النهاية: “سيضع ريال مدريد ضمن عقد فينيسيوس الجديد شرطًا جزائيًا قيمته مليار يورو”.

Miller and Vaughan settle differences

Geoff Miller has had a meeting with Michael Vaughan to dispel differences over the selection of fast bowler Darren Pattinson for the second Test against South Africa

Cricinfo staff23-Jul-2008
Geoff Miller wanted a clarification from Michael Vaughan about his comments on Darren Pattinson’s selection © Getty Images
Geoff Miller, England’s chairman of selectors, has had a meeting with Michael Vaughan to dispel differences over the selection of the team for the second Test against South Africa. Vaughan, England’s captain, had earlier said that the inclusion of Darren Pattinson had unsettled the team.”We have analysed everything,” Miller said. “We have cleared the issues that supposedly were involved in the last Test. I’ve had a chat to Michael Vaughan and I sat down with the selectors and there are no more problems.”We are trying to make every decision on a sensible basis. We are responsible for selecting the side and people who know me well know there is a logic and a reason behind all the selections made.”Miller had stated before the meeting that he wanted to hear Vaughan’s side after Pattinson’s selection was made into a “massive issue by the media.”After Vaughan called Pattinson “a confused selection”, Miller defended the inclusion of the 29-year-old fast bowler who had played only 11 first-class matches prior to his Test debut. “We garner opinion by talking to umpires, county coaches and other players and then we go and monitor the players that those chats throw up,” Miller told the . “Once we’ve got a rounded picture, and if they’re the kind of player Peter and Michael are looking for, we’ll consider them for selection.”Pattinson’s presence in the XI meant England went in with only five specialist batsmen with wicketkeeper Tim Ambrose batting at No. 6. After the ten-wicket defeat to South Africa, Vaughan said: “The whole Friday morning (the first morning of the Test) unsettled the team. You change the team by two players, there are players playing out of position and you leave out a player like Paul Collingwood, who is a huge player in the side, of course it has an effect.”Vaughan also said the team spirit was lacking during the second Test. “We didn’t feel as much of a unit this week. I have a huge belief that we need to be a unit in Test cricket.”However, he defended Pattinson’s performance (match figures of 2 for 96) and was unhappy with the severe criticism the fast bowler faced. “He tried his guts out and bowled some good spells. I felt sorry for him. He’s not been in the set-up and didn’t know anyone. We didn’t know him, so it was difficult for him.”

Desatenção e cansaço: corintianos tentam explicar tropeço em Itaquera

MatériaMais Notícias

Ser campeão paulista e avançar na Copa Sul-Americana deixaram o Corinthians empolgado para a sequência da temporada. A maratona bem sucedida de decisões, no entanto, também trouxe problemas para o Timão. Nos dois últimos jogos, por exemplo, Léo Príncipe e Pablo sofreram com problemas musculares. E, neste sábado, o cansaço foi apontado pelos alvinegros como preponderante para o empate em 1 a 1 com a Chapecoense.

– Posso falar por mim que pesou um pouco, mas isso não é desculpa, a gente tem que estar bem, tentamos recuperar o máximo possível, mas a maratona é forte assim mesmo. Tanto é que a agora a gente vai ter um tempo pra descansar e reorganizar- lamentou o meia Rodriguinho, que deu assistência para Jô no duelo.

Além do desgaste físico, problemas clínicos como resfriados e febre acometeram o elenco. O técnico Fábio Carille, inclusive, disse que alguns atletas precisaram até ir a hospitais. O goleiro Cássio lamentou o ocorrido, mas não deixou de citar a desatenção da equipe para ceder o empate à Chape na estreia do time no Campeonato Brasileiro.

-Temos sempre que buscar três pontos em casa no brasileiro, a gente não conseguiu. Em uma desatenção a gente acabou tomando o gol. Não é desculpa, mas a gente está meio debilitado, um monte de jogador com gripe, tomando injeção. A pegada é forte nos jogos. Claro que não é desculpa, mas no final ali bateu um pouco do cansaço e agente não conseguiu manter o ritmo – disse.

A comissão técnica do Corinthians deu folga dupla para o grupo, que descansará domingo e segunda-feira, voltando aos trabalhos no CT Joaquim Grava somente na próxima terça.
